概括
困难菌感染 (CDI) 是一个主要的医疗威胁. 一个多方面的干预策略成功地在一年内将CDI发作减少了77%,证明了它在对抗这种感染方面的有效性.

背景情况:
- 困难菌是医院获得的腹的主要原因,导致严重的发病率和死亡率.
- 症状范围从轻微的腹到严重的伪膜性结肠炎和死亡.
- 2008年观察到克洛斯特里迪奥伊德困难感染 (CDI) 病例的增加.
研究的目的:
- 评估多面干预策略对减少CDI发作事件的影响.
- 评估医疗保健环境中干预的长期有效性.
主要方法:
- 南方卫生和社会护理信托基金 (SHSCT) 实施多方面的方法来打击CDI.
- 在干预实施之前和之后监测医院患者的CDI发作.
主要成果:
- 65岁以上患者的CDI发作在第一年内减少了77% (从2008-09年的164次减少到2009-10年的37次).
- 观察到CDI发作持续减少,到2021/2022年与2008/09年相比,CDI发作减少了64%.
- 这项干预措施导致医院获得的CDI显著下降.
结论:
- 多方面的干预策略对于降低医疗保健中获得的CDI的发生率至关重要.
- 这些策略的成功实施可以导致CDI利率大幅降低.
- 需要持续监测和干预,以保持低CDI发病率.

Drugs for Treatment of Crohn's Disease in IBD Using Immunomodulatory Agents
475
Crohn's disease is an inflammatory bowel disorder marked by chronic inflammation of the GI tract. Various treatment strategies for Crohn's disease are employed, such as immunomodulatory agents, glucocorticoids, and biologics or anti-TNF therapy. Azathioprine (Imuran), a commonly used immunomodulatory drug for Crohn's disease, is converted in the body to mercaptopurine, which inhibits purine biosynthesis and cell proliferation. Treating Helicobacter pylori in Peptic Ulcers: Antimicrobial Therapy
1.1K
Helicobacter pylori, a resilient gram-negative bacterium, can thrive in the stomach's harsh, acidic environment. Infection with H. pylori leads to a cascade of events within the stomach lining. One of the critical disruptions caused by this bacterium is the interference with somatostatin production, a hormone responsible for regulating acid secretion.
